Mr. Romero was a Navy WW II Underwater Demolition Team 15 Veteran, awarded the
Asiatic Pacific Ribbon 2 stars, American Theater Ribbon, Philippine Liberation
1 star, Victory Medal and the Bronze Star Medal. He was a member of the UDT
Seal Museum, Ft. Pierce FL, and the Carpenters Local Union #1489 of Burlington.
